1969 Ford Capri vs. 2005 Volvo XC70

To start off, 2005 Volvo XC70 is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Ford Capri.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Ford Capri would be higher. At 2,548 cc (6 cylinders), 1969 Ford Capri is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Volvo XC70 (206 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 64 more horse power than 1969 Ford Capri. (142 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Volvo XC70 should accelerate faster than 1969 Ford Capri.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Volvo XC70 weights approximately 356 kg more than 1969 Ford Capri.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Volvo XC70 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1969 Ford Capri.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Volvo XC70 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Volvo XC70 (320 Nm @ 1500 RPM) has 99 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Ford Capri. (221 Nm @ 3100 RPM). This means 2005 Volvo XC70 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Ford Capri.
